Xenoblade is an upcoming role-playing video game published by Nintendo and developed by Monolith Soft for the Wii console.
The Japanese release was named Xenoblade to honor Tetsuya Takahashi, "who poured his soul into making this and who has been working on the Xeno series". The game is set for a "spring 2010" release. The North American version's title is still unconfirmed and listed with the temporary name "Monado: Beginning of the World.
It has also been stated that the game will convey the feeling of freedom to the player, and won't be as focused on cutscenes and story as its sibling games.

Xenoblade will attempt to convey the feeling of freedom through large, expansive environments.
Characters
Shulk is the main protagonist of Xenoblade. Early details show that he is able to wield the Excalibur-like Xenoblade. His first act upon acquiring the "destined weapon" is to hunt the mararuders that destroyed his village, a "Colony 9."
Fiorun is Shulk's childhood friend and the younger sister of Dunban, the previous wielder of the Xenoblade.
Dunban is the oldest PC (30). For reasons yet to be revealed, he wielded the Xenoblade against a vague enemy (perhaps the parties involved with the struggle between the universe's twin gods). It is not known if Dunban won or lost this conflict, but he sports a wound from that battle that persists despite attempts to heal it.
Rein - Another of Shulk's friends. Although he is a member of Colony 9's Defense Force, he can often be seen at Shulk and Fioren's side.
Carna - A Defense Force warrior of Colony 6. Her speciality is projectile weapons.
Melia - A powerful mage that lives on the god Kyoshin.
Riki - A member of as-of-yet unnamed race of merchants. Riki is a "black sheep" for his denying his race's destiny. A natural story-teller, he will go on at length that he is actually the TRUE legendary hero spoken in the prophecies
